Similarly, it was not possible to use it in the world’s most popular messaging app, WhatsApp, but now Chat GPT can be easily used in WhatsApp.
OpenAI has announced that Chat GPT is now available for users on WhatsApp, now you can also use Chat GPT’s AI search engine for free.
How can Chat GPT be used on WhatsApp?
ChatGPT is easy to use on iPhones and Android devices. For this, you need to add the number 1-800-242-8478 to your WhatsApp contacts.
If the number is not added, you can also access ChatGPT on WhatsApp by clicking on this link.
Another option to access ChatGPT is to scan the QR code below, after which you will be able to use the AI chatbot.
It should be noted that ChatGPT will not have advanced voice mode or visual features for WhatsApp users, the chatbot will be limited to answering your questions.
The good thing is that OpenAI’s new GPT One mini model will also be available to users.
OpenAI is also working on developing a dedicated chatbot for WhatsApp, which will not require an account to use.
